Mar 08 Minutes - 2008/03/21 11:20 Minutes of the Peterborough Cycling Club
Committee Meeting
Held on 17th March 2008

Members present:
Alex Harrison (in the chair),Tim Cockerell, Dave Yarham, John Dawson, Rod Auckland, Joe Ippolito, John Savill, Terry Wright, Richard Roach, Keith Steiner

Apologies:
John McCarthy, Jeremy Harrison

The Minutes of the previous Committee Meeting were agreed to be a true record of that meeting.

Matters Arising:
ß Alex thought that BeWell of Langtoft might be willing to contribute to Open Event sponsorship, and would approach them with a request.
ß Organisation of the NCRA RR on 29 Mar was well in hand, but Ian would welcome further support on the day.

Correspondence:
ß Alex had received details about cycling friendly accommodation in Italy from Dan Broccoli.
ß Rod and Secretary had received NDCA 2008 Handbooks.
ß Rod had received Roadpeace correspondence which he passed to Keith.

Open Events:
Arrangements for the three Open events were in hand. John Dawson had changed the venue from the Sawtry College to the Village Hall, saving some costs.

Capital Expenditure:
This was complete, and money saved as the Scout Hall will allow us to use their tea urn.

Second Claim Members:
As second claim members did not have the full benefit of Club membership, it was agreed that their annual subscription would be £10; charges for events to be either £15 for the year or £2 per event.

Club Off-Road Section:
The web site claims that the Club caters for off-road cycling, but this part of our activities had been dormant for some time. It was agreed that Richard would coordinate investigations into resurrecting this activity. In particular, we needed to establish what benefits the Club could offer to the considerable number of local off-road riders.

Newsletter:
Secretary needed contributions for the next edition by the end of March. Keith agreed to provide a short article on the benefits of our affiliation to Road Peace.

New Members:
One new membership application was endorsed. Secretary would remind members who had not yet renewed for 2008 to do so.



Treasurer’s Report:
Current account was still on the low side at £357 (deposit £274), as capital expenditure costs had been paid, and the outlay on new clothing had not yet been recovered.

Quartermaster:
The new clothing was being distributed, but progress was slow.

Road-Race Secretary’s Report:
Three of our members had been riding the NCRA series, and Brett’s win (second claim for PCC) and other good performances noted.

Time Trial Secretary’s Report:
John French was our fastest rider in the Hardriders events with 56.07. The last of the Winter 10s would take place on 22nd March; support for the series had been reasonable and Dave was prepared to run one again next winter. He had tried out the potential evening 10 course replacement. It was agreed that it would be tried out during the year, with plenty of notice given and appropriate safety measures in place.

Press Secretary’s Report:
Event results had been sent to four of the local newspapers.

Any Other business:
Joe was trying to attract a sponsor for Open Events, and needed guidance on what the Club was expecting. It was agreed to concentrate on this year’s September Open RR, with a view to increasing the prize money and giving the event appropriate publicity.

Date of the next meeting: 21st April; There being no further business the meeting closed at 2046.
